How hard is it to get a Fulbright Grant? A: Very hard. From year to year the rate of success has remained virtually the same—a solid 20\%. However, the “odds” vary from country to country because it depends on the popularity of the country and the number of grants that country offers.

How are Fulbright Scholars selected?

The competition for Fulbright Program grants is merit-based. Eligibility criteria will vary by program and by country. Candidates are selected based on a variety of factors, that may include (but are not limited to) academic qualifications, project feasibility, personal leadership ability, and available grant funds.

Can you go home during Fulbright?

The Fulbright Program requires grantees to return to their home countries when their academic exchange activities in the United States are concluded.

Can you stay in the US after Fulbright?

Q: Can Fulbright participants stay in the United States after their program, or do they need to return to their home country? A: Upon completion of their program, Fulbrighters are required to return to their home country to complete the two-year residency requirement before becoming eligible to apply for other visas.

How competitive is the Fulbright Scholarship?

The Fulbright Program is extremely competitive, and scholarships are awarded in nearly every field, from science to the performing arts. The program is open to anyone interested in applying, but recipients are chosen based on merit, professional and academic achievement, and the ability to represent their countries and cultures.

    The answer is No. You do not need to give the TOEFL test at the time you apply to the Fulbright. Only successful (Principal and Alternate) Fulbright candidates will be required to take the TOEFL. Candidates are notified of the success of their application in October after their interviews, which are conducted in September.
